Climate change, or global warming, is a highly debated topic, with differing opinions regarding its causes, effects, and potential solutions. President Donald Trump has expressed skepticism towards climate change, going so far as to call it a "hoax" created by China to harm the United States. In this essay, I strongly disagree with President Trump's views on climate change and will provide several reasons why.

First and foremost, the overwhelming scientific consensus is that climate change is real, and it is caused by human activity, primarily the burning of fossil fuels. Climate scientists around the world have provided a substantial body of evidence to support this claim, including rising temperatures, melting ice caps, and more frequent extreme weather events. Denying the existence of climate change is not only ignoring this scientific evidence but also putting the lives of billions of people at risk.

Secondly, the effects of climate change are already being felt worldwide, and they are only going to get worse if we do not take immediate action. Heatwaves, droughts, floods, and wildfires are becoming more frequent and intense, causing widespread devastation and loss of life. The impacts of climate change are not limited to natural disasters; they also include the spread of diseases, reduced agricultural productivity, and the loss of biodiversity.

Thirdly, addressing climate change presents an opportunity to create new jobs and stimulate economic growth. The transition to a low-carbon economy will require investments in renewable energy, energy efficiency, and other green technologies. These investments will create new jobs in fields such as solar and wind power and will help reduce our dependence on fossil fuels, which are becoming increasingly expensive and scarce.

In conclusion, I strongly disagree with President Trump's views on climate change. The evidence clearly shows that climate change is real, and it poses a significant threat to our planet and its inhabitants. Denying its existence and ignoring its effects will only make the situation worse. It is our responsibility to take action now to mitigate the impacts of climate change and create a sustainable future for generations to come.
